The club Board would like to offer a belated thank you to everyone who helped ensure that the Hereford game last Tuesday ran so smoothly.

There were many people involved in making sure the ground was ready for the evening. On the night providing entry through four turnstiles and a busy officials entrance was also undertaken by volunteers along with programme and raffle sales, helping in the clubhouse and running the pop up bar at the Town End.

We know that our personnel who talked to Hereford supporters were grateful for their kinds comments about arrangements.

We know too that there were varying views about the decision to segregate and how we chose to do it. We are grateful to all our supporters who came out on the evening to support the team, often not from their usual vantage points - thank you for your understanding. We were of course relieved by the weather and that the 300 red ponchos we purchased were not required.

The club worked closely with Thames Valley Police, MJ Events Stewarding and Newman and CB Protection to provide a safe environment within the ground. We know that there were issues outside of the ground which TVP dealt with and, as acknowledged by Hereford FC too these were not instigated by regular Banbury United supporters.
